Ashok Sharma Record In SMAT: 23 year old gun bowler Ashok Sharma of Rajasthan (Ashok Sharma) Syed Mushtaq Ali Trophy 2025 on Tuesday, 16 December (Syed Mushtaq Ali Trophy 2025) Created history by dismissing two Mumbai players in the match. It is noteworthy that now he has become the bowler taking the most wickets in a season of SMAT tournament.

First of all, know that in this match held at Maharashtra Cricket Association Stadium, Ashok Sharma gave 48 runs to Mumbai in his quota of 4 overs and dismissed batsmen like Shardul Thakur and Atharva Ankolekar. With this, he completed his 22 wickets in the current season of SMAT and broke the record of Baroda player Lukman Meriwala and became the bowler who took the most wickets in a season of Syed Mushtaq Ali Trophy.
It is noteworthy that Lukman Meriwala had taken 21 wickets in 9 matches for Baroda in the year 2013/14 season and had created this great record. Ashok Sharma has now made this amazing record in his name by taking 22 wickets in 10 matches for Rajasthan in SMAT 2025. He is the number-1 bowler of the current season, after him in this list is Anshul Kamboj of Haryana, who has taken 20 wickets in 10 matches.
Gujarat Titans got the diamond: Gujarat Titans, captained by Shubman Gill, have found the diamond for the upcoming IPL season in the form of 23-year-old Ashok Sharma, who was bought by the GT franchise for Rs 90 lakh in the mini auction. Let us tell you that apart from Gujarat Titans, on the auction table, champion teams like Kolkata Knight Riders, Chennai Super Kings and Rajasthan Royals also wanted to buy Ashok Sharma, due to which the first bid on him, which started at Rs 30 lakh, reached Rs 90 lakh and finally Gujarat Titans made him their share at this amount.
The situation of the match was like this: In this SMAT match, Mumbai team won the toss and chose to bowl first, after which Rajasthan team scored 216 runs losing 4 wickets in 20 overs on the basis of brilliant half-centuries by Mukul Chaudhary (54*) and Deepak Hooda (51). In response, Sarfaraz Khan scored 73 runs on just 22 balls for Mumbai, while Ajinkya Rahane played an unbeaten inning of 72 runs on 41 balls. On the basis of this, Mumbai achieved the target of 217 runs in 18.1 overs and won this exciting match by 3 wickets in the end.
